Now that the temperature is beginning to drop, you might be looking to add a quality leather jacket to your cold-weather wardrobe. If that’s the case, John Elliott and Blackmeans have got your back.

During a visit to Japan for the development of his fall/winter 2016 collection, Elliott stopped by the Japanese brand’s showroom where he was able to meet its team. It didn’t take long for the American designer to notice their similarities.

“When I went to see their creations, I realized how much we have in common,” Elliott wrote in statement. “The Guys at Blackmeans are authentic and devoted to their craft. They are leather artisans who work with their hands on products they sell in their own shop, and who in their time off listen to punk rock. It was a very good match for us.”

The meeting, which was originally supposed to last 20 minutes, turned into a four-hour long discussion in which the brands began forming the collaborative collection. They eventually decided to create a couple leather pieces that fused signature elements from each brand.

The stadium jacket featured pleated motorcycle detail that’s used frequently by Blackmeans, while the moto jacket featured gussets that are used heavily throughout John Elliott’s latest collection.

“We collaborated with Blackmeans because their attention to detail and quality of leather and hardware are second to none,” Elliott explained. “These are some of my favorite products and at the end of the day, I love this product because these are jackets I want in my closet.”

You can check out the pieces in the lookbook here. The John Elliott x Blackmeans collection will drop Oct. 11.
